How to fill out an ADRC intake form:

01
Start by carefully reading the instructions on the form. This will ensure that you understand what information is required and how to provide it accurately.
02
Provide your personal information, such as your full name, address, phone number, and date of birth. This will help the ADRC (Aging and Disability Resource Center) identify you and contact you if needed.
03
Indicate your demographic information, such as your gender and ethnicity. ADRCs collect this information for statistical purposes to better serve diverse populations.
04
Specify your living situation, including whether you live alone, with family members, or in a nursing home. Understanding your current living situation will assist ADRC in tailoring their services to your needs.
05
Provide details about your health insurance coverage. This can include your Medicare or Medicaid numbers, private insurance information, or any other coverage you may have. It is crucial for ADRC to know what services you are eligible for.
06
Describe your current health condition or disability. Be as detailed as possible about your specific needs and any challenges you may be facing. This will help ADRC understand how they can best assist you.
07
Indicate any medications you are currently taking. Include the name of the medication, dosage, and frequency. This will help ADRC coordinate with healthcare providers and ensure that your medications are properly managed.
08
Provide information about your income and financial resources. ADRC may need this information to determine your eligibility for certain programs or services.
09
If applicable, provide details about any caregiver or family member involved in your care. This can include their contact information, relationship to you, and their role in supporting you.
10
Finally, sign and date the form to certify that the information provided is accurate to the best of your knowledge.

Who needs an ADRC intake form:

01
Individuals who are seeking assistance with aging or disability-related services can benefit from filling out an ADRC intake form. This can include older adults, individuals with disabilities, or their caregivers.
02
Individuals looking for information on available resources and support programs in their community can also benefit from completing an ADRC intake form. ADRCs can provide guidance and connect individuals to the appropriate services.
03
Healthcare professionals, social workers, or other professionals working with older adults or individuals with disabilities can also use the ADRC intake form to help their clients access necessary support and resources.

The ADRC intake form is a document used to gather information about individuals seeking services from the Aging and Disability Resource Center.
Individuals seeking services from the Aging and Disability Resource Center are required to file the ADRC intake form.
To fill out the ADRC intake form, individuals must provide personal information, details about their needs or disabilities, and any other relevant information requested on the form.
The purpose of the ADRC intake form is to collect necessary information about individuals seeking services in order to assess their needs and provide appropriate support.
Information such as personal details, medical history, living situation, and specific needs or disabilities must be reported on the ADRC intake form.
